Code § 10-33-127","heading":"Foreign corporation - Admission of foreign corporation conducting activities - Obtaining licenses and permits","body":"A foreign corporation may not:\n1.Conduct activities in this state or obtain any license or permit required by this state until it has procured a certificate of authority from the secretary of state.\n2.Conduct in this state any activity that is prohibited to a corporation incorporated under this chapter.\n3.Be denied a certificate of authority because the laws of the state or country where the corporation is incorporated differ from the laws of this state.","path":["Title 10 Corporations","Chapter 10-33 Nonprofit Corporations"],"source_url":"https://ndlegis.gov/cencode/t10c33.pdf","current_through":"2026-07-31T11:12:02","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-09-02T21:04:14Z","sha256":"c85f0b4609a703f6fe4561c0ab27bfb1f63d99d871b72727a078e62977054dad","source_id":"us-nd","stale":true,"prev":"us-nd/n.d.-cent.-code-10-33-126","next":"us-nd/n.d.-cent.-code-10-33-128"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
